About Us
NavGurukul is a not-for-profit founded in 2016 with a vision: to create access to aspirational careers for students from marginalized communities. We are deeply committed to the transformation of our students, empowering them to hold high-impact jobs and live lives full of opportunities. We believe in an equitable alternative to higher education where students not only learn the right skills but also cultivate the mindsets necessary to thrive in today’s world.

Key Responsibilities
- Build and nurture relationships with our alumni by engaging with them regularly, understanding their career journeys, and identifying ways to support them in their professional and personal growth.
- Create innovative engagement strategies that go beyond traditional networking events and foster a true sense of community among alumni.
- Design and implement programs that provide continuous learning, growth, and career opportunities for alumni, helping them navigate the complexities of their professional journeys.
- Lead new initiatives aimed at alumni career development, mentorship opportunities, and community-building activities.
- Support the alumni’s professional growth by facilitating knowledge-sharing platforms, workshops, and collaborative learning opportunities.
- Encourage alumni to give back to the community by mentoring, volunteering, or offering financial support.
- Set up and manage a fund led by alumni to help with emergencies or provide support to alumni and students in need.
- Work with alumni to find ways they can actively help and inspire future students.

Compensation
The compensation for this role ranges from ₹35,000 to ₹40,000 per month, depending on your experience. If you bring additional skills or experience that align well with the role, the pay could go up to ₹40,000 to ₹50,000 per month.
